Will Twitter Get an Edit Button in 2022?
One of the most anticipated features in Twitter has been the edit button. Currently, you are unable to edit a tweet after it has been published. Users have been vocal about the need for an edit button for many uses.
It can be used for grammatical errors, correcting facts, and more.
Do you want an edit button?
— Elon Musk (@elonmusk) April 5, 2022
This Twitter poll currently has over 4.4 million votes, which reflects Twitter users’ desire for the new feature. Musk also misspelling “yes” and “no” is also a play on the need for the edit button. The actual Twitter account also tweeted “we are working on an edit button,” which means it’s even more likely for it to be installed by the end of the year.
Betting on the Twitter edit button was made available on BetUS. The odds reflect a very strong chance that it happens. If you are a doubter though, there’s some serious value in the “no” option at (+800).
At the end of the day, the edit button is highly desired by Twitter users. Musk purchasing Twitter should only increase its chances of being installed.
Donald Trump and New York Times Props in 2022
That isn’t the only Twitter-related betting prop available. You can actually bet on Donald Trump to publish a tweet by 2022, or if New York Times will leave Twitter by then. Both of these accounts have had their run-ins over the years.
Trump was handed a permanent suspension from the app last year. He was first locked out of his account for 12 hours after calling January 6th capitol rioters “patriots,” and was issued a warning.
He violated the warning once more and was handed the permanent ban. Musk was very vocal about his opposition to the ban. He said it was “insane” and was strongly against it. Now that Musk has made the big financial move to purchase Twitter, it seems that he will play a role in reinstating Trump’s Twitter account.
On the contrary, New York Times could leave Twitter. If they do, (+800) odds would cash, while the odds for them to stay are at (-3000). Musk’s all about free speech, so it seems unlikely that more accounts will be banned or leave Twitter at this point.
The betting props are made to where only one option is worth betting on. Although, they also indicate what is likely to happen on the platform in 2022. Be on the lookout for an edit button and possibly Donald Trump’s return to Twitter in the coming months.
